After I got my iPod I found that the most efficient way to sync up my music (I have over 6 gigs) was to make several playlists. Most of the playlists would simply be normal playlists. However, I made one of them for the sole purpose of seeing how much space all my mp3's would take up. All it is is a playlist that contains every song I'll put on my iPod. If I want to edit a playlist I only use songs from the master playlist, and so on.

My concern is, my iPod and my master playlist both list 1019 songs (as of the last time I hooked it up). The difference is, my master playlist says I've got 3.6 gigs of space for 1019 songs, my iPod says I've got 4.3 gigs of space for the same number of songs. What's going on? Is it somehow duplicating all of the songs from my other playlists? Does anybody have any ideas?
